Massachusetts Sues UnitedHealthcare Over Alleged $100 Million Fraud
Massachusetts has taken legal action against UnitedHealthcare, accusing the company of defrauding the state’s Medicaid program of over $100 million by inflating the health status of seniors enrolled in its Senior Care Options program. This initiative combines Medicare and Medicaid benefits, and the state claims UnitedHealthcare manipulated data to appear as though seniors needed more care than they actually did, thus securing higher payments. This lawsuit highlights the broader issue of healthcare fraud, which has significant implications for taxpayer money and the integrity of public health programs.
